Narrative:
The instructor was conducting a circuit emergencies lesson with the student pilot, focusing on simulated engine failure after take-off (EFATO). Prior to the exercise, the instructor provided a detailed briefing and demonstrated the EFATO manoeuvre twice. The student pilot then successfully performed one EFATO under the instructor’s direction. During the student pilot’s second attempt, the instructor reduced engine power to idle to simulate the engine failure. The student pilot immediately pulled the control stick fully aft, contrary to the briefing instructions. The instructor verbally commanded the student pilot to apply forward pressure on the control stick while the instructor simultaneously applied forward pressure to counteract their input. The instructor however, was unable to overpower the student pilot’s control input. The instructor attempted to initiate a go-around. Despite the instructor’s efforts, the aircraft descended rapidly and made a hard landing on the runway. The impact resulted in the collapse of the nosewheel, and the aircraft came to rest at the edge of the runway.
